Description
Zion Chapel, formerly known as Zion Strict Baptist Chapel, is a small building dated 1834. It is constructed of red brick and features a pediment with a round-headed niche in the tympanum. The chapel has two round-headed windows, which still have their glazing bars intact, and includes a porch.
